JK Harris helps client on "long, hard trip" to tax resolution
JK Harris helped a South Carolina native reduce her monthly amount owed to the IRS using an Installment Agreement. JK Harris assists taxpayers who owe IRS tax debt using a variety of strategies.


GOOSE CREEK, SC, March 07, 2010 /24-7PressRelease/ -- Owing back taxes to the IRS is stressful. Fortunately, the IRS has programs in place, such as the installment agreement, to help taxpayers get back on track.

When Carol Vagelatos of Bluffton, SC came to JK Harris and Company, the nation's largest tax representation company, she was frustrated. She was making an honest effort to repay the tax debt she owed and had attempted to negotiate an installment agreement with the IRS. However, she was not successful in getting the monthly installments down to a level she could afford to repay.

An installment agreement is simply a repayment plan where the taxpayer makes monthly payments to the IRS to repay the taxes owed. While the agreement allows the full payment of the tax debt in smaller, more manageable amounts, the downside to the agreement is the taxpayer is still charged interest and penalties.

"The IRS wanted Mrs. Vagelatos to pay $1,800 a month, an amount she just could not afford," said Gina Anton, Director of Corporate Communications for JK Harris. "She tried working with them, but when they would not relent, she came to JK Harris for help."

To negotiate with the IRS to reduce the amount of the monthly payment amount took a lot of time, patience and paperwork to prove a financial need for a lowered payment amount.

"It was a long, hard trip" nearly two years of negotiations on my behalf by my case specialist and licensed taxpayer representative to achieve an agreement I could afford to pay back on a monthly basis," Vagelatos said. "Hundreds of documents were asked of me and I know my case specialist spent endless hours working on my behalf."

In the end, the IRS' Taxpayer Advocate and an independent review determined the amount should be much lower, knocking the payment amount down to a $400 a month payment.
